近年来,区块链技术以其去中心化、透明性和安全性等优点迅速崛起,对多个行业产生了深远的影响,其中包括广告...
区块链数据库(Blockchain Database)是一种采用区块链技术构建的数据存储系统。在这一系统中,数据以区块的形式进行存储,并按照时间顺序链接成条形链,形成一个去中心化的、可追溯的和不可篡改的数据记录。这种新型数据库的特点是分布式存储,不同于传统的中心化数据库,区块链数据库有效提升了数据的安全性和完整性。
多年来,区块链数据库的概念被不断深入探讨和应用。在这一领域,有几个关键特点让它与传统数据库形成了鲜明的对比:
在传统数据库中,数据存储通常由单个中心化的服务器控制。而区块链数据库没有单一的控制中心,数据复制分散在多台节点上。每个节点都保存了完整的数据库副本。这种去中心化的特性不仅提升了数据存储的安全性,也使数据更加透明,任何对数据的修改都需要网络中多个节点的共识。
区块链以其独特的加密技术保证了数据的不被篡改。一旦信息被写入区块链,想要做任何修改都是几乎不可能的,因为修改的代价非常高昂且需要得到大多数节点的同意。这种特性在金融服务和法律文件存储等领域尤为重要,因为它确保了数据的真实性和可靠性。
所有的交易或数据被记录在区块链上,任何人都可以查看。然而,尽管数据是公开的,用户的身份可以通过加密手段保持匿名。因此,区块链数据库不仅提供了透明的视图,还确保了个人隐私。这一点在供应链管理中展现得尤为明显,通过可追溯性,可以对每个产品的生产、交易过程进行清晰的追踪。
区块链数据库支持智能合约(Smart Contracts)功能,它是指在特定条件触发下自动执行的合同程序。这意味着数据不仅仅是被存储,还能引发各种操作,比如付款、传递信息等。智能合约减少了中介的需求,提高了交易效率,降低了成本。许多区块链平台,如以太坊,都广泛使用智能合约技术。
区块链使用密码学技术确保数据的安全性。每个区块都有一个哈希值和前一个区块的哈希值,这使得篡改一个区块将影响后续所有区块的哈希,几乎无法实现。此外,区块链网络中多重节点的存在也为数据提供了冗余,一旦某个节点发生故障,其他节点仍能保障数据的完整性。
虽然区块链数据库的设计在某些方面相比传统数据库可能在性能上有所不足,然而随着技术的进步,各种扩展解决方案正不断涌现。例如,Layer-2 解决方案如闪电网络致力于提升交易处理速度和降低成本。这些创新将使得区块链数据库在未来能够处理更高的负载和更广泛的应用场景。
区块链数据库的优势使其在多个行业中逐渐得到应用和认可。以下是一些突出的应用领域:
在金融行业,区块链数据库可以用来简化交易流程、降低成本并提高透明度。通过区块链,跨境支付变得异常高效,用户能够在几秒钟内完成资金的转移,我们可以看到一些金融科技公司和传统银行正在积极探索基于区块链的解决方案。
区块链为供应链管理提供了极大的便利。通过追踪产品从生产到消费的每一个环节,不仅提高了生产的透明度,还减少了欺诈和伪造的可能性。这种技术促使许多公司重新思考他们的供应链结构,及其透明化的潜力。
医疗行业的数据安全十分重要,区块链数据库为患者提供了更好的隐私保护。在这种数据库中,医生和医疗机构可以在保护病患隐私的同时共享关键信息,提高医疗质量和效率。
区块链在产权和法律文件管理方面的应用同样广泛。通过记录所有权变更的历史,区块链便于处理产权争议,减少了法律纠纷的发生。这为房地产等领域提供了更清晰的产权管理模式。
尽管区块链数据库有诸多优势,但它仍面临一些挑战。在链上的数据存储效率与成本之间如何平衡,是当前技术发展必须解决的问题。此外,如何处理监管与隐私的冲突,以及区块链技术的普及性与接受度等问题,也需要各方共同努力。未来,随着更多企业探索区块链的潜力,我们将看到更具创新性的解决方案出现,从而推动多个行业转型。
在此背景下,区块链数据库无疑将作为一种重要的技术手段,改变我们的数据存储和管理方式。随着技术的不断演进及社会接受度的提升,区块链数据库在各行各业的应用将愈加深远和广泛。